## Service Accounts — Webhook Delivery Retries

The Hullwright dispatcher retries failed webhook deliveries with exponential backoff: five attempts over roughly thirty minutes, then dead-lettering. When investigating stuck deliveries, authenticate to the dispatcher's admin endpoint using the on-call service account, which permits replaying dead-lettered events but not editing subscriber configs. Note every replay in the incident log. The account's current key follows.

service key, tadup-tahog: zpat7_wB1tnEL

The waveform preview service in Chorusline is emitting truncated renders for audio files longer than twenty minutes. The downsampling worker allocates its peak buffer from the declared duration in the container header, and several recent uploads carry incorrect metadata, so the buffer fills early and the tail of the waveform is silently dropped. Future maintainers should note this is a long-standing assumption, not a regression. The affected file list, buffer sizing logic, and proposed fix are documented on the internal page.

runbook for badug-kadup: https://confluence.zemvarlabs.internal/projects/browse/display/projects/bd1b

During the Pellam Street incident, the Farrowly address autocomplete widget fired a lookup on every keystroke once the debounce timer was accidentally disabled, overwhelming the geocoder and triggering cascading timeouts at checkout. On-call: the fix restores debouncing and adds a client-side minimum query length plus a per-session request budget. If the geocoder latency alarm fires again, verify these guards are active before escalating to the Mapping team. The agreed values, now enforced in config rather than hardcoded, are listed below.

tuning constants:
QUOTAS = {
    "druwyn": 5,
    "holix": 5,
    "zorath": 5,
    "holwyn": 10,
}

Runbook: Scanline barcode bridge

If warehouse scans stop flowing into Cartwheel, it's almost always the bridge service on the Dunmore floor box wedging after a USB hiccup. Bounce the service first — nine times out of ten that fixes it. If not, check the queue depth before escalating. When restarting, make sure the bridge comes up with these settings.

deployment values, yafop-bajef:
[gilok]
team = ulaius
access_code = ac_423664
host = gilok.sivrelhq.corp
port = 9200
owner = pelius.istax
peer = eliok.torvasoft.internal